php^(ph破解版官方中文站下载)
# 简介PHP(全称:Hypertext Preprocessor)是一种广泛应用于Web开发的服务器端脚本语言。它以高效、灵活和强大的功能著称,被全球数百万开发者使用。本文将深入探讨PHP的历史、特点、应用领域以及未来发展趋势,并通过多级标题的形式对相关内容进行详细解析。---## PHP的历史沿革### 起源与发展PHP最初由Rasmus Lerdorf于1994年创建,起初只是用于个人网站的管理工具。随着需求的增长,Lerdorf将其开源并命名为“Personal Home Page Tools”,后来演变为更通用的“PHP: Hypertext Preprocessor”。经过多次版本迭代,PHP已经成为Web开发的重要组成部分。### 里程碑版本-
PHP 3
(1998年):标志着PHP正式成为一门成熟的编程语言。 -
PHP 5
(2004年):引入了面向对象编程特性,极大提升了代码复用性和可维护性。 -
PHP 7
(2015年):性能大幅提升,支持类型声明及现代编程模式。 -
PHP 8
(2020年):新增 JIT编译器,进一步优化运行效率。---## PHP的核心特点### 动态语言的优势PHP是一种解释型动态语言,允许开发者快速构建应用程序而无需显式声明变量类型。这种灵活性使得PHP非常适合原型开发和小型项目。### 强大的生态系统PHP拥有庞大的社区支持和丰富的第三方库资源,例如Laravel、Symfony等框架,极大简化了复杂项目的开发流程。### 广泛的兼容性PHP能够无缝运行在多种操作系统上(如Windows、Linux、macOS),并且与主流数据库(MySQL、PostgreSQL等)良好集成。---## PHP的应用领域### Web开发PHP是构建动态网站的标准选择之一。无论是简单的博客系统还是复杂的电子商务平台,PHP都能胜任。### API开发借助Swoole或ReactPHP等异步框架,PHP可以轻松实现高性能的RESTful API服务。### 数据处理PHP常用于数据清洗、报表生成等后端任务,特别是在企业级应用中扮演着重要角色。---## PHP的未来趋势### 性能优化随着JIT编译器的加入,PHP在执行速度上的表现已经接近甚至超越某些静态语言。未来,PHP将继续朝着更高的性能迈进。### 微服务架构越来越多的企业开始采用微服务架构来拆分大型单体应用,而PHP凭借其轻量级特性和良好的扩展能力,在这一领域也展现出巨大潜力。### 安全性提升近年来,网络安全问题日益受到关注。PHP官方团队正在不断改进安全机制,帮助开发者编写更加健壮的应用程序。---## 结语作为一门历经多年发展的成熟语言,PHP依然保持着旺盛的生命力。无论是在传统Web开发还是新兴技术领域,PHP都展现出了不可替代的价值。对于希望进入或深耕IT行业的学习者而言,掌握PHP无疑是一条明智的选择之路。
简介PHP(全称:Hypertext Preprocessor)是一种广泛应用于Web开发的服务器端脚本语言。它以高效、灵活和强大的功能著称,被全球数百万开发者使用。本文将深入探讨PHP的历史、特点、应用领域以及未来发展趋势,并通过多级标题的形式对相关内容进行详细解析。---
PHP的历史沿革
起源与发展PHP最初由Rasmus Lerdorf于1994年创建,起初只是用于个人网站的管理工具。随着需求的增长,Lerdorf将其开源并命名为“Personal Home Page Tools”,后来演变为更通用的“PHP: Hypertext Preprocessor”。经过多次版本迭代,PHP已经成为Web开发的重要组成部分。
里程碑版本- **PHP 3**(1998年):标志着PHP正式成为一门成熟的编程语言。 - **PHP 5**(2004年):引入了面向对象编程特性,极大提升了代码复用性和可维护性。 - **PHP 7**(2015年):性能大幅提升,支持类型声明及现代编程模式。 - **PHP 8**(2020年):新增 JIT编译器,进一步优化运行效率。---
PHP的核心特点
动态语言的优势PHP是一种解释型动态语言,允许开发者快速构建应用程序而无需显式声明变量类型。这种灵活性使得PHP非常适合原型开发和小型项目。
强大的生态系统PHP拥有庞大的社区支持和丰富的第三方库资源,例如Laravel、Symfony等框架,极大简化了复杂项目的开发流程。
广泛的兼容性PHP能够无缝运行在多种操作系统上(如Windows、Linux、macOS),并且与主流数据库(MySQL、PostgreSQL等)良好集成。---
PHP的应用领域
Web开发PHP是构建动态网站的标准选择之一。无论是简单的博客系统还是复杂的电子商务平台,PHP都能胜任。
API开发借助Swoole或ReactPHP等异步框架,PHP可以轻松实现高性能的RESTful API服务。
数据处理PHP常用于数据清洗、报表生成等后端任务,特别是在企业级应用中扮演着重要角色。---
PHP的未来趋势
性能优化随着JIT编译器的加入,PHP在执行速度上的表现已经接近甚至超越某些静态语言。未来,PHP将继续朝着更高的性能迈进。
微服务架构越来越多的企业开始采用微服务架构来拆分大型单体应用,而PHP凭借其轻量级特性和良好的扩展能力,在这一领域也展现出巨大潜力。
安全性提升近年来,网络安全问题日益受到关注。PHP官方团队正在不断改进安全机制,帮助开发者编写更加健壮的应用程序。---
结语作为一门历经多年发展的成熟语言,PHP依然保持着旺盛的生命力。无论是在传统Web开发还是新兴技术领域,PHP都展现出了不可替代的价值。对于希望进入或深耕IT行业的学习者而言,掌握PHP无疑是一条明智的选择之路。